    Tyre advice

    When replacing tyres, consider the wet grip and fuel efficiency. Generally better fuel efficiency leads to worse wet grip. In independent testing the difference between the best and worst tyre for wet grip was 46m stopping difference. Each grade of wet stopping distance equates to 2 car lengths...

    Gridserve chargers

    Why would you want to charge to 95%? The charge rate drops after 85%, so quicker to charge to just over 80%, then stop and charge again later. Really don't understand why anyone sits on the charger trying to get to 100%, takes far to long. My brother does this regularly in his ID5 and on a same...

    What % should I routinely charge a MG ZS EV LR to?

    For the LR I would go further and say if your normal use is only 15%, charge to 60 or 70%. The higher you charge the quicker the battery capacity will degrade with the LR battery chemistry.
